What is the Water theme?
The Water theme brings together authoritative spatial information about the location, extent and movement of water across NSW.
The theme is built on hydrology, the study of how water moves through the landscape. As well as structures and reference points used to monitor and manage water systems, it includes:
- rivers
- creeks
- lakes
- coastlines
- other water features.
In NSW, the Water theme plays an important role in:
- water security
- flood and drought management
- environmental protection
- infrastructure and land use planning.
The theme supports consistent, evidence-based decisions across government and aligns with the national ANZLIC Foundation Spatial Data Framework. It works with datasets from other jurisdictions.
The data is maintained and published by DCS Spatial Services, providing a reliable, statewide foundation for policy, operations and digital services.
Data sourcing
The Water datasets were originally created by named gazetteers through NSW Government topographic mapping programs from the 1970s onwards. In 2011, the waterbody data, including natural and manmade dams, were spatially upgraded to be consistent with a national specification.
Water theme datasets are maintained by DCS Spatial Services and are compiled from a combination of:
- authoritative NSW Government custodians
- high‑resolution aerial imagery and elevation data.
Technical information
Water datasets are published with metadata and service standards that are recognised across Australia to support discovery, interoperability and reuse.
The datasets include the following standards:
- metadata compliant with AS/NZS ISO 19115, ISO 19115‑2, ISO 19139 and the ANZLIC Metadata Profile v1.1
- data products aligned with AS/NZS ISO 19131:2008
- services supported by OGC‑compliant WMS and WFS.
Data is released under Creative Commons Attribution 4.0 (CC BY 4.0).

How the Water theme supports spatial analysis
The Water theme supports integrated spatial analysis by connecting with other Foundation Spatial Data Framework themes, including:
- Elevation and Depth
- Place Names
- Transport.
The Water theme provides consistent, statewide coverage across NSW for use at local, regional and state levels. It supports planning for floods, drought and long-term climate impacts, and strengthens water security through a clearer understanding of waterways, water bodies and storage systems.
NSW water datasets contribute to initiatives such as the Australian Hydrological Geospatial Fabric, to provide consistent water information across Australia.
